This third and final issue to the epic "David Boring" sells out so fast it leaves us spinning! This, the largest issue of Eightball to date picks up where issue #20 left off, resolving everything, including who shot David and the secret of the Yellow Streak. Plus, what was that business about the end of the world? Suffice it to say it's the fattest and most eagerly awaited issue to date from alternative comicdom's best-selling and most respected cartoonist. What more do you need to know?...Oh yeah...it continues in the same 7-1/4" x 10-1/4" format as the previous two "David Boring" issues.
